PostPosted: Tue Feb 22, 2011 8:54 am    Post subject: Re: Circle Hook Sizes Reply with quote

FoldCatOne wrote:
I am looking for small ones for use in fishing for Mangrove Snapper, Sheephead, Pompano and Croaker. The smallest I can find are size 6.


6's are pretty small. I use size 1's VMC Sport circle hooks for mangroves and croaker, and then I bump it up to the 1/0's and 2/0's and even the 3/0's for pompano fishing on the beach. Rocky at Roys' will tell you to use 5/0's Kahles. I've done the Pepsi challenge with circles, you'll have to believe me, and for the $$ and quality,
VMC is the way to go, IMHO.
